Audit Context Building Skill

Systematically build comprehensive understanding of a protocol before diving into code-level analysis. Rushing into code without context leads to missed vulnerabilities, wasted time, and incomplete coverage.


Why Context Building Matters

Without Context With Context
Miss cross-contract interactions Map all trust boundaries before reading code
Spend time on low-risk functions Prioritize functions handling value
Overlook admin-only backdoors Know every privileged role and its power
Miss assumptions about external protocols Document all external dependencies upfront
Can't identify broken invariants Invariants identified before code review

Time Allocation

For a typical DeFi protocol audit:

Phase Time % Activity
Context building 15-20% Architecture mapping, docs review, invariants
Function-level analysis 40-50% Line-by-line code review with context
Cross-cutting concerns 20-25% Reentrancy, access control, value flows
Reporting 10-15% Writing findings, severity classification

Capabilities

Architecture Mapping

  • Contract inventory with purpose and SLOC
  • Inheritance hierarchy (is-a relationships)
  • Contract interaction graph (calls-to relationships)
  • Proxy/upgrade pattern identification
  • Library usage and dependency versions

Function-Level Analysis

  • Access control classification (unrestricted / role-gated / owner-only)
  • State change documentation (reads vs writes)
  • External call mapping (call targets, data flow, return handling)
  • CEI pattern compliance per function
  • Edge case identification

Protocol Understanding

  • Protocol invariant identification and documentation
  • Trust boundary mapping (what trusts what)
  • Token and value flow tracing
  • Fee mechanism analysis
  • Integration point documentation

Risk Surface Identification

  • Centralization risk assessment (admin power)
  • Oracle dependency risk
  • External protocol dependency risk
  • Upgrade mechanism risk
  • Economic design risk areas
